#63adb3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63adb3 is composed of 38.8% red, 67.8%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.7% cyan, 3.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 184.5 degrees, a saturation of 34.5% and a lightness of 54.5%. #63adb3 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#005b67.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

● #63adb3 color description : Slightly desaturated cyan.
#63adb3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63adb3 has RGB values of R:99, G:173, B:179 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 6532531.
